    Very little movement in the forex in Vientiane.

    When I was there in May / June it was 1 USD = 8000 kip (round figures always). It ranged between 7999 to 8001 over the 26 days I was working there.

    Changes are miniscule.

    Money changers were offering same rate as banks, and even my hotel was offering 7995 kip to the dollar.

    I used credit card for all my bill payments and in restaurants because that gave me the best rate.
